区块链技术的迅速发展为各行各业带来了颠覆性的变革。随着应用场景的不断扩大,区块链平台的建设和管理显得尤为重要。然而,如何有效地管理区块链平台的生命周期,确保其高效运行与稳定发展,是众多企业面临的重要课题。本篇文章将详细介绍区块链平台的生命周期管理,包括构建、运行、维护及四个关键阶段,并探讨相关管理策略和最佳实践。
区块链平台的生命周期管理可以分为四个主要阶段:构建、运行、维护和。每个阶段都有其独特的挑战和需求,因此需要制定相应的策略和流程。
构建阶段是区块链平台生命周期的起点,涉及技术选型、系统架构设计、网络搭建等关键环节。在这一阶段,企业需要明确其区块链平台的目标,选择适合的技术(如以太坊、Hyperledger Fabric、EOS等),并设计相应的架构。
在构建阶段,还需要考虑到以下几个要素:
一旦区块链平台构建完成,进入运行阶段。在这一阶段,企业需要保证区块链网络的正常运行,监控平台的性能和安全,及时处理可能出现的问题。
运行阶段的核心任务包括:
在运行一段时间后,区块链平台进入维护阶段。此阶段的重点是对平台进行持续的维护和更新,以适应不断变化的业务需求和技术发展。
维护阶段需要关注的方面包括:
阶段是区块链平台生命周期管理的重要环节。通过数据分析与用户反馈,企业可以找到各类问题和瓶颈,并进行相应的措施。
阶段的主要工作包括:
区块链平台在运行过程中可能会遭遇多种安全问题,如51%攻击、智能合约漏洞、 DDoS攻击等,了解这些安全问题并采取预防措施是运营区块链平台的关键。
1.1 51%攻击
51%攻击发生在某个实体控制了超过50%的网络算力时,从而可以操控网络,对交易进行双重支付等操作。为防范此类攻击,建议采用更加分散的共识机制,增强网络的安全性。
1.2 智能合约漏洞
智能合约是区块链的重要组成部分,但其代码一旦发布便不可更改,因此智能合约中的漏洞可以被黑客利用,对平台造成灾难性后果。定期审计和代码审查成为预防手段。
1.3 DDoS攻击
DDoS攻击通过大量虚假请求淹没网络,从而导致正常用户无法访问。采取流量控制、访问限制等策略可以有效减轻DDoS攻击的影响。
综上所述,区块链平台应当全面评估潜在的安全风险,制定相应的安全策略,确保平台的安全和稳定。
选择合适的区块链技术栈对于平台的长期成功至关重要。考虑到不同的业务场景和需求,企业应系统地评估各种技术选项。
2.1 了解不同的区块链类型
区块链一般可以分为公链、私链和联盟链。公链如比特币,适合去中心化应用;私链如Hyperledger Fabric,适合企业内部应用;联盟链则介于两者之间,适合多个信任方共同参与。
2.2 评估性能和扩展性
不同的区块链技术在交易处理速度、网络扩展性上有较大差异,企业需根据自身的业务需求进行评估,确保技术的高效性和适应性。
2.3 考虑社区支持和文档
活跃的社区支持和良好的文档资源可以帮助开发者解决问题,促进技术快速迭代。选择一个有良好社区支持的技术栈,可以降低开发的风险。
通过综合考虑这些因素,企业可以选择最适合的区块链技术栈,为平台的成功奠定基础。
监管政策必然影响区块链平台的运营,保证合规性是平台成功的重要保障。企业需要了解所在地区的法律法规,并据此进行合规设计。
3.1 了解法律法规
不同地区对区块链和加密货币有不同的法律法规。企业需要熟悉并遵循相关政策,尤其是在数据保护和隐私方面的要求。
3.2 进行合规审计
定期进行合规审计,确保平台的操作符合相关法律法规。通过第三方合规审计机构的认证,可以增加用户的信任度。
3.3 制定合规政策
企业需结合自身实际情况,制定包括反洗钱、数据监管、用户身份验证等方面的合规政策,确保全公司的运营均符合相关法规。
通过系统的合规措施,企业可以有效降低法律风险,增强用户信任,为平台的持续发展奠定基础。
区块链技术正处于迅速发展之中,其未来发展趋势将深刻影响各行各业。
4.1 跨链技术的发展
随着多条区块链的并存,跨链技术成为重要的发展方向。通过跨链技术,不同的区块链可以实现互联互通,促进资源共享和协同合作,提高整体效率。
4.2 企业级区块链的普及
越来越多的企业开始应用区块链技术,尤其在供应链金融、身份验证、数据共享等领域,利用区块链提高效率和透明度,推动企业数字化转型。
4.3 去中心化金融(DeFi)的兴起
去中心化金融是区块链的重要应用场景之一,通过去中心化的智能合约,可以实现借贷、交易和投资等金融活动,提高金融服务的可达性和透明度。
综上所述,区块链技术的未来充满机遇,企业应积极应对变化,争取在这一新兴技术领域占得先机。
提升用户体验是区块链平台成功的重要因素。企业应系统评估用户需求,设计友好的交互界面和简便的操作流程。
5.1 用户需求调研
通过问卷、访谈等方式深入了解用户的真实需求,掌握用户在交易过程中的痛点和需求,制定相应的方案。
5.2 交互界面设计
设计友好的交互界面,让用户快速上手并能便捷完成操作。使用简洁明了的语言,提供清晰的指引,避免用户在使用过程中的困惑。
5.3 提供全面的支持和反馈渠道
建立有效的用户支持和反馈机制,及时解决用户遇到的问题,并根据用户反馈持续平台功能和用户体验。
通过以上措施,企业可以有效提升区块链平台的用户体验,增强用户粘性,为平台的成功运营提供保障。
区块链平台的生命周期管理是一个复杂而重要的过程,涵盖构建、运行、维护与四个关键阶段。通过有效的生命周期管理,企业可以确保区块链平台的稳定运行,提高业务效率和用户体验。同时,随着区块链技术的迅速发展,企业应持续关注行业动态与技术变革,及时调整策略,抓住机遇,迎接挑战。
该文旨在为对区块链平台生命周期管理感兴趣的企业、开发者和相关从业者提供理论指导和实践参考,以促进其在区块链技术应用方面的发展。